POSSESSORY INTEREST. If this Contract results in Contractor having possession of, claim or right to the possession of land or improvements, but does not vest ownership of the land or improvements in the same person, or if this Contract results in the placement of taxable improvements on tax exempt land (Revenue & Taxation Code Section 107), such interest or improvements may represent a possessory interest subject to property tax, and Contractor may be subject to the payment of property taxes levied on such interest. Contractor agrees that this provision complies with the notice requirements of Revenue & Taxation Code Section 107.6, and waives all rights to further notice or to damages under that or any comparable statute.
POSSESSORY INTEREST. Licensee acknowledges that they have been informed that under Section 107 of the Revenue and Taxation Code of the State of California, the Marin County Assessor is required to place a value on all possessory interests. Possessory interest is defined as the right of a private taxable person or entity to use property owned by a tax-exempt agency for private purposes. A possessory interest tax will, therefore, be levied by the County Assessor on this property against the Licensee as of the lien date, which is March 1 of each year.

POSSESSORY INTEREST. The Parties agree that no possessory interest is created by this Agreement. However, to the extent that a possessory interest is deemed created by a governmental entity with taxation authority, Permittee acknowledges that City has given to Permittee notice pursuant to California Revenue and Taxation Code Section 107.6 that the use or occupancy of any public property pursuant to this Agreement may create a possessory interest which may be subject to the payment of property taxes levied upon such interest. Permittee shall be solely liable for, and shall pay and discharge prior to delinquency, any and all possessory interact taxes or other taxes levied against Permittee’s right to possession, occupancy, or use of any public property pursuant to any right of possession, occupancy, or use created by this Agreement.
